Is 250 157 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 250 157 is about 500.157.

Thus, the square root of 250 157 is not an integer, and therefore 250 157 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 250 157?

The square of a number (here 250 157) is the result of the product of this number (250 157) by itself (i.e., 250 157 × 250 157); the square of 250 157 is sometimes called "raising 250 157 to the power 2", or "250 157 squared".

The square of 250 157 is 62 578 524 649 because 250 157 × 250 157 = 250 1572 = 62 578 524 649.

As a consequence, 250 157 is the square root of 62 578 524 649.
